//
// This alters the text string cutscene_disptext.
// Use the typical string drawing functions to display it.
// Returns 0 if \0 is reached (end of input)
//
static UINT8 F_WriteText(void)
{
INT32 numtowrite = 1;
const char *c;
tic_t ltw = I_GetTime();
if (cutscene_lasttextwrite == ltw)
return 1; // singletics prevention
cutscene_lasttextwrite = ltw;
if (cutscene_boostspeed)
{
// for custom cutscene speedup mode
numtowrite = 8;
}
else
{
// Don't draw any characters if the count was 1 or more when we started
if (--cutscene_textcount >= 0)
return 1;
if (cutscene_textspeed < 7)
numtowrite = 8 - cutscene_textspeed;
}
for (;numtowrite > 0;++cutscene_baseptr)
{
c = &cutscene_basetext[cutscene_baseptr];
if (!c || !*c || *c=='#')
return 0;
// \xA0 - \xAF = change text speed
if ((UINT8)*c >= 0xA0 && (UINT8)*c <= 0xAF)
{
cutscene_textspeed = (INT32)((UINT8)*c - 0xA0);
continue;
}
// \xB0 - \xD2 = delay character for up to one second (35 tics)
else if ((UINT8)*c >= 0xB0 && (UINT8)*c <= (0xB0+TICRATE-1))
{
cutscene_textcount = (INT32)((UINT8)*c - 0xAF);
numtowrite = 0;
continue;
}
cutscene_disptext[cutscene_writeptr++] = *c;
// Ignore other control codes (color)
if ((UINT8)*c < 0x80)
--numtowrite;
}
// Reset textcount for next tic based on speed
// if it wasn't already set by a delay.
if (cutscene_textcount < 0)
{
cutscene_textcount = 0;
if (cutscene_textspeed > 7)
cutscene_textcount = cutscene_textspeed - 7;
}
return 1;
}
static void F_NewCutscene(const char *basetext)
{
cutscene_basetext = basetext;
memset(cutscene_disptext,0,sizeof(cutscene_disptext));
cutscene_writeptr = cutscene_baseptr = 0;
cutscene_textspeed = 9;
cutscene_textcount = TICRATE/2;
}
